Ingredients

Adjust Servings:
1/2 cup champagne
1/2 cup brown sugar
1/4 cup honey
1/4 cup dijon mustard
1 teaspoon tarragon
2 boneless skinless chicken breasts

    Steps

    1
    Done

    Grill, Bake or Pan-Sear Chicken Breasts Until No Longer Pink in Center.

    2
    Done

    in a Small Saucepan Add Champagne, Brown Sugar, Honey, Dijon and Tarragon.

    3
    Done

    Over Medium Heat, Stir Mixture Often Until a Glaze Forms, About 4 Minutes.

    4
    Done

    Return Chicken to Pan and Turn Chicken Several Times to Glaze.
